Voice to text (Listen)

  1. Press ⌘5 to start recording. The menu bar icon shows a recording badge.
  2. Speak into the selected microphone. Parakeet is the default engine (European languages). Whisper is optional for broader coverage. Default recording limit is 300 seconds (change this in Settings).
  3. Press ⌘5 again to stop. Processing runs on-device.
  4. The transcript is copied to the clipboard and, by default, pasted into the field you were typing in. Turn that off in Settings → General if you only want the clipboard. Insert needs Accessibility permission.

Text to speech (Read)

Supertonic voices are English-only.

  1. Select text in any application.
  2. Press ⌘6. OneSentence copies the selection, speaks it, and restores the previous clipboard.
  3. Other apps can duck in volume while speech is playing. The session can appear in macOS Now Playing.
  4. Press ⌘6 again to stop early.

Snippets (Universal Palette)

  1. Open Settings → Snippets and choose a folder. OneSentence watches that folder.
  2. Put plain files there: .txt, .md, .snippet, or Emacs .yasnippet.
  3. Press ⌘⇧Space anywhere. Type to fuzzy-search, then Enter to paste. Clipboard history is preserved.

Local history

If History is enabled, each transcription is stored in a local database on your Mac. Open History from the menu bar, search, and click an entry to copy it. You can delete individual rows or clear the database. Nothing is synced to a cloud account.

Voices

Ten English Supertonic voices (five male, five female) are available after the model download. Switching voices does not require a further download.

Audio

Choose input and output devices without restarting. Optional ducking lowers other apps while OneSentence is speaking or recording.
